My name is Bel Harper, and I am a Sydney based media executive, with a 25 year career working with advertising agency customers, direct customers, brands and commercial partners, including 12 years working on and monetising Qantas audiences across Clubs, Business Lounges, Inflight Entertainment and Wi-Fi, and more recently within the 6 key Chairmans Lounges across Australia. My current role is Executive Group Director of Product Strategy at oOh!media (ASX:OML), Australia’s largest out of home media operator, where I am a member of the Executive Leadership Team. My experience spans sales, product and commercial areas across the media industry in Australia and North America, and throughout my career I have developed a diverse set of skills and passion for customer strategy and problem solving. I am highly experienced at deciphering audience insights through leading data sets such as Quantium and CBA IQ, and using those insights to understand and enhance customer experience and monetise audiences in highly varied environments and at different consumer journey points. During my time in media, I have established myself as a respected industry leader, recognised for my product strategy work particularly around the aviation and airport media sector, by creating award winning value propositions and commercialising customer experience by connecting data, content and technology. I created and led the Qantas Lounges and IFE value proposition, creating the ‘end to end’ audience journey, by identifying how Qantas’ customers interacted at different points of their journey, and developing products to integrate utility such as flight information displays with walk to gate times, shortform Travel Insider and news content and headlines, Wi-Fi enablement notifications and destination weather. Ultimately, this customer centric approach met the needs of Qantas staff in lounges, Qantas from a commercial perspective (including Loyalty, who pay for and use the platform to drive offers to existing customers) , the Qantas passenger through enhanced experience and subsequently, the paying advertiser. In addition, I have been a key contributor to competitive tender wins and contract renewals, designing customer and revenue strategies for commercial parties such as Melbourne and Brisbane Airports and most recently Sydney CBD Metro, Woollahra Council Street Furniture and Macquarie’s Martin Place Metro precinct.
